Backpacking Mt. Adams & Mt Jefferson!
When: 4pm Saturday-late Sunday evening
What: Drive up the Whites, hike in a few miles, and camp at the Valleyway tentsite. Bright and early Sunday morning, we'll head up and climb Adams, then Jefferson. Triumphant, we'll head back down to the cars and head back to campus. 3 miles the first day, 10 miles the second day.
Why: The views are gorgeous, we'll climb some of the highest peaks in the Whites, and backpacking is fun!
Cost: $12 DOC/ $20 non-DOC
Leaders: Abby Leibowitz and Jeremy Brouillet

Come Hike Mt. Cardigan!
Leave at 10am, back by 2pm
Leaders: Steve Tebbe and Fredrik Eriksson
Come do a simple 4 mile hike up to the summit of Mt. Cardigan! Because of a historic fire, it has a barren summit, which leads to some of the best views in the areas. End your Green Key Weekend with a great adventure outside! Actual cardigans not required. Hope to see you there!
Cost: $3 for DOC members and $5 for non-DOC members.
